1. 程式人生 > >小甲魚零基礎入門學習python 第12章 p12_6.py p12_7.py 錯誤分析及更正

小甲魚零基礎入門學習python 第12章 p12_6.py p12_7.py 錯誤分析及更正

p12_6.py

執行時可能會出現如下錯誤:

錯誤原因是 找不到 getX 這個名字,解決方法如下:

把程式最後一行 

x = MyProperty(getX,setX,delX)

Tab鍵縮排一下,歸在 class C: 這個類下邊,就可以了,與上邊的def 在同一列。

p12_7.py

執行 temp.fah可能會出現如下錯誤:

錯誤原因是 嘗試訪問未知物件錯誤,解決方法如下:

把程式最後一行

fah = Fahrenheit()

Tab鍵縮排一下,歸在 class Temperature: 這個類下邊,就可以了,與上邊的  cel = Celsius()  在同一列。